Transaction 157e14ad13e399ee721496e211aaa6b76529bc2f35e8042edda430c752f4f93a
1 Input
2 Outputs
- 157e14ad13e399ee721496e211aaa6b76529bc2f35e8042edda430c752f4f93a:0
- 157e14ad13e399ee721496e211aaa6b76529bc2f35e8042edda430c752f4f93a:1
value 2574623
address 1HZf75MsQUJFVaKYBCfqoqFvN8yQRX4P7D
value 2132683
address 1HJdXHLSawzbhB52Lvxm7pjkZSjGY9jeeK